The UK Same-Sex Partner Visa

The UK same-sex partner visa allows couples to live together in the United Kingdom. There are two categories of visas available for same-sex partners:

Partner visa

Marriage visa

The partner visa applies to couples who are not yet married, while the marriage visa applies to couples who are legally married in a country where same-sex marriage is legal. These visas allow same-sex partners to live and work in the United Kingdom without having to worry about their legal status.

Eligibility Criteria for Same-Sex Partner Visa

In order to apply for the same-sex partner visa, couples must meet certain eligibility criteria:

The couple must have been in a relationship for at least two years prior to the application.

The couple must intend to live together permanently in the United Kingdom.

The sponsoring partner must earn at least £18,600 per year or have savings to meet the financial requirement.

If the couple meets these eligibility criteria, they can apply for the same-sex partner visa and start planning their life together in the United Kingdom.
